Course Content

• Geospatial Data Acquisition and Preprocessing (Remote Sensing, LiDAR, GPS)
• Geospatial Data Management and Databases (PostgreSQL/PostGIS, Spatial Databases)
• Cartography and Geovisualization (Map Design, GIS Software, Data Presentation)
• Geospatial Analysis Techniques: Spatial Statistics and Modeling (Spatial Autocorrelation, Regression)
• Geographic Information Systems (GIS) Software Proficiency (ArcGIS, QGIS)
• Geocoding and Address Matching (Data Cleaning, Spatial Referencing)
• Spatial Interpolation and Prediction (Kriging, Inverse Distance Weighting)
• Raster and Vector Data Analysis (Overlay Analysis, Spatial Join)
• Application of Geospatial Analysis in Environmental Management (Conservation, Sustainability)

Career Role Description
Geospatial Analyst (GIS Specialist) Analyze spatial data using GIS software, creating maps and reports for various applications. Strong problem-solving and data visualization skills are essential.
Remote Sensing Specialist Process and interpret satellite and aerial imagery, extracting valuable insights for environmental monitoring, urban planning, and resource management. Expertise in image processing techniques is critical.
Geographic Information Systems (GIS) Manager Lead and manage GIS teams, overseeing projects, and ensuring data accuracy and integrity. Strong leadership and project management abilities are required.
Geoinformatics Consultant Provide expert advice and support on geospatial data management, analysis, and application development. Excellent communication and client relationship skills are needed.
Cartographer Design and create maps and other geospatial visualizations for a variety of purposes, encompassing technical expertise and creative design skills.
